California wants to buy huge ranch near Livermore to create new state park

When Gov. Gavin Newsom announced his $222 billion proposed state budget on Friday, he mentioned that he wants legislative leaders to dedicate $20 million from a one-time surplus to help purchase new public parkland. Newsom declined to say where the new park might be, suggesting the asking price could “go up” if he revealed details.

Former Oakland Coliseum chief Scott McKibben arraigned on conflict of interest charges

Alameda County prosecutors filed one felony conflict of interest charge and one misdemeanor conflict of interest count against Scott McKibben, 66, on Nov. 27 for his alleged illegal activity between Nov. 1, 2018, and June 25, 2019.
